Pep Guardiola says harmony at Manchester City is exceptional but insisted he will not be the manager for as long as Sir Alex Ferguson was in charge of Manchester United. Guardiola is in his sixth year at City, a tenure that has so far been supremely successful. While his opening season was trophyless, the 50-year-old has since led City to three Premier League titles, the FA Cup, four successive League Cups and last seasonâs Champions League final. A former clinical trial overseer for a contractor holding trials of Pfizerâs COVID-19 vaccine is pressing forward with a lawsuit against Pfizer and her former company despite the U.S. government declining to side with her. Brook Jackson was fired by the contractor, Ventavia Research Group, in 2020. She came forward as a whistleblower in 2021. Jackson filed a False Claims Act suit against Pfizer, Ventavia, and another company involved in the trial, ICON. OTTAWA, OntarioâThe center of Canadaâs capital city was flooded on Feb. 12 by thousands of protesters demanding an end to the countryâs COVID-19 mandates and restrictions. Many more joined the ongoing trucker-led protest in Ottawa with the arrival of the weekend. Its numbers grew from the night of Feb. 11 into the next morning, as supporters seemingly poured into the city. Greater masses of people were particularly noticeable on Parliament Hill and then later on the streets, where they spilled out from the immediate vicinity of the truck blockade. Hair stylist Joel McCauley had seen too many colleagues burn out after a perpetual cycle of work, eat and sleep, so when he opened his own salon in Cardiff he was determined to do things differently. Staff at Slunks in Morgan Arcade now work a four-day week for no less pay than for working five days. They are happier, more productive and provide a better service, said McCauley. âWhen you have more time, you can think about life in a different way,â he said. âAt work, youâre likely to have more energy and fewer non-productive days.
